IRGC gunboat fires on container ship near Oman as US-Iran ceasefire extends

1 min read
Source: The Jerusalem Post
TL;DR Summary

A IRGC gunboat reportedly fired on a container ship about 15 nautical miles northeast of Oman, with the crew safe and the ship damaged; the incident comes as US President Trump extends the temporary US-Iran ceasefire and keeps the Strait of Hormuz blockade in place. The live blog also notes ongoing regional developments including IDF strikes in southern Lebanon, a Beit Imerin arson attempt near Nablus, potential Houthis Red Sea attacks, Iran's execution of a man accused of spying for Israel, Huckabee’s planned participation in Israel-Lebanon talks, two rounds of broader Strait-of-Hormuz planning, and fresh sanctions on Iranian weapon suppliers.
